Abstract

The utility model provides a special door with good sealing performance, which relates to the technical field of special doors and comprises a door frame body, wherein an inner chamber is arranged inside the door frame body, sliding channels are respectively arranged at the bottom and the top of the inner chamber, a limiting groove is arranged on the inner bottom surface of the sliding channel at the bottom, a fixed seat is fixed on the inner wall of the sliding channel at the bottom close to one side edge, an electric telescopic rod is fixed inside the fixed seat, a sliding block is sleeved on the outer wall of the movable end of the electric telescopic rod, a door plate is fixed at the top of the sliding block, a limiting block is fixed at the bottom of the sliding block, the limiting block is connected between the inner walls of the limiting grooves in a sliding manner, and a sealing groove is arranged on one side of the door plate. Technical Field
The utility model relates to the technical field of special doors, in particular to a special door with good sealing performance.
Background
Along with industrial development, the protection requirements on people and environment are higher and higher, so that the requirements on special doors of factory buildings leading to the outdoors are stricter and stricter, the functions of the special doors are more various and comprehensive, and the performance requirements under the influence of single or multiple external factor disasters can be met on the premise of ensuring normal passing of the doors.
But the most needs manual push-and-pull of current common special door, because have sealed effect, so the gap department of door and door frame has set up watertight fittings, and this frictional force that has just caused between door and door frame increases, need use very big strength just can push and pull the door, and this has brought inconveniently for old man or child's in the family use.
SUMMERY OF THE UTILITY MODEL
The utility model aims to drive a door to move in a door frame through an electric telescopic rod, and solves the problem that the traditional special door can be pushed and pulled only by great effort, so that inconvenience is brought to the use of the old or children at home.

Preferably, a plurality of springs are fixed on the inner wall of one side of the inner chamber, a buffer plate is welded between one ends of the springs, and a sealing strip is fixed on one side of the buffer plate.
Preferably, one side of the sealing strip faces one side of the sealing groove, the buffer plate is slidably connected to the inside of the inner chamber, and the door plate is located inside the inner chamber.
Preferably, a connecting block is fixed at the position, close to one side edge, of the top of the door plate, and a roller is fixed at the top of the connecting block.
Preferably, the inner walls of the two sides of the sliding channel at the top are provided with rectangular sliding grooves, and the rollers are located between the inner walls of the sliding channel at the top.
Preferably, the front surface and the rear surface of the door panel are fixed with rectangular sliding blocks near the top edge.
Preferably, the two rectangular sliding blocks slide in the rectangular sliding grooves correspondingly.
Compared with the prior art, the utility model has the advantages and positive effects that,
1. when the door frame is used, the sliding block is driven to slide through the stretching of the electric telescopic rod, the door plate is fixed to the top of the sliding block, the sliding block moves to drive the door plate to be opened and closed, the limiting groove is formed, the limiting block is fixed to the bottom of the sliding block and is connected to the limiting groove in a sliding mode, the sliding block is driven to move through the stretching of the electric telescopic rod, the door plate is more stable when being opened and closed, the roller is arranged on the top of the door plate and is located between the inner walls of the top sliding channels, and friction force between the door plate and the door frame body can be reduced in the sliding process of the door plate.
2. According to the door frame, the springs are fixed on one side of the inner chamber, the buffer plate is fixed at one end of each spring, the door plate can be buffered when the door plate is closed, the door frame body is prevented from being scrapped due to impact on the door frame body, the service life of the door frame body is shortened, the sealing strip is fixed on one side of the buffer plate, the sealing groove is formed in one side of the door plate, the seam of the door plate and the door frame body in closed butt joint can be sealed, and the sealing performance of the special door is improved.
